5 Things To Remember Before Your Website Launch
Print This Article Ezine Publisher Send To Friends Add To Favorites Post A Comment Suggest Topic Report Author

What is the purpose of your website? This is the question you should be asking yourself. Do you think that the purpose of your site is to give away free products? Or could it be one of those all things to all people kind of websites. If you truly don't know here are five points for you to consider.

1) Sell Something You're in business to make money I presume so sell something, this should be the purpose of your website, get a million visits to your Website and get ready for huge bandwidth fees. Get a million paying customers and you will make your bank manager smile. A visitor to your website should have two choices which are

Buy your product or service

Leave email and other information for follow up

2) Build your list I don't know you, so I have no idea what level you've reached in online marketing. If this part of the article bores you I apologise but you do recognise its importance.You must build your list it will be your most valuable asset, if you have no list then you don't have a business that's how important it is to you.

3) Your unique web position What makes your website unique? Why should your visitors buy from you Instead of your competitors.The above questions need to be answered if you want long term loyalty from visitors who buy something from you. there are a number of things that could make your website position unique such as price you could make your prices lower and have a higher sales turnover but those razor thin profit margins will hurt you if a big multi-purpose store which sells the same product decides to become your neighbour.

Quality: you could concentrate on making you're product or service of a higher quality to appeal to a more exclusive market. Switch your main focus to providing the best value for money stress this point to your customers who may be thinking that they can get whatever you are selling at a lower price some where else.

Warranty or guarantee: 30 day guarantees are old hat, besides it a requirement by law. To make your website really stand out offer your customers guarantees that last for a year or even two. This will show how confident you are about your goods a variation of this would be to offer your product for free for a thirty day period. Let your customers try before they buy and you will have a much better chance of dominating the market.

4) Joint venture deals Internet marketing and advertising have a stormy relationship its like a bad marriage between two people who constantly argue with one another.The problem is that advertising costs money sometimes a lot of money and its risky You never know what will work or won't work but it's a necessary evil especially if you're new to online marketing. Once you've established yourself and have built a responsive list of customers your best and most profitable method of marketing will be through joint ventures.

The advantages of a joint venture is that it eliminates the risks and cost associated with normal advertising. All you have to do is contact other successful webmasters and offer them a percentage of your sales if they market your products to their lists.

5) what's your backend like It's a marketing fact you can't succeed online if you have only one income stream If you sell your product once to a customer and then look for other customers you'll never make a decent income that you can live on. What you need is a

backend product which can produce multiple streams of income for you. A ebook is an example you could use, say you sell it for $20 on your website spend $100 on advertising and get 6 sales that's $20 dollars you've just made, not much money I know but it gets worse after processing fees you actually make less than $20.

Still using your ebook lets say you were smart enough to add 10 more offers for products and services into the text of the ebook at an average selling price of $100 your cut is 40% that's $40 per sale if only 20% of your customers buy one product then you would make assuming you had 60 customers

60 customers x 20% buy = 12 customers x $40 each = $480

Now do you see the power of the backend sale and why you must include it in your Marketing plans as soon as possible
